POLISH APPLESAUCE CAKE

5 stars! This is the best cake I've ever made and I'm not the greatest baker, but this is fool proof. It is so moist and flavorful with perfect texture. Great anytime of year and is quick and easy for entertaining. You'll get a lot get compliments with this one. This gets even better over time and will last awhile. I keep it on the counter covered with foil. Great for breakfast!

Provided by Suzy_Q

Categories     Dessert

Time 55m

Yield 1 13x9 pan

Number Of Ingredients 13



Polish Applesauce Cake image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350.
  • Cream butter and sugar (or margarine). Add vanilla and eggs and beat well. Sift flour, powder, soda and salt together. Add to egg mixture and alternate when adding the applesauce mixing well.
  • Grease a 13x9x2" pan and pour in the mixture spreading out evenly.
  • Combine mixture for topping and spread evenly over batter and bake for 45 minutes.
  • Let cool in pan.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 4371.5, Fat 166.4, SaturatedFat 80.1, Cholesterol 728.1, Sodium 3941.8, Carbohydrate 693.4, Fiber 16.5, Sugar 415.1, Protein 49.3

1/2 cup butter (1 stick) or 1/2 cup margarine (1 stick)
1 cup s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la
2 eggs
2 cups fl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 1/2 cups applesauce
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1 cup brown sugar
2 tablespoons butter or 2 tablespoons margarine
1/2 cup walnuts, chopped

GRANDMA'S APPLESAUCE CAKE

This moist applesauce cake recipe is a treasured heirloom passed down from my Grandma Stuit, who cooked for a family of 13 during the Depression. At reunions, it's the first dessert gone...including the crumbs! -Joanie Jager, Lynden, Washington

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h

Yield 16 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 13



Grandma's Applesauce Cake image

Steps:

  • Place raisins and hot water in a small bowl; set aside. , In a large bowl, cream shortening and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in egg. Combine the flour, baking soda, salt and spices; add to creamed mixture alternately with applesauce and water. Drain raisins; fold into batter with the walnuts. , Transfer to a greased 13x9-in. baking pan. Bake at 300° for 40 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Place pan on a wire rack. Dust with confectioners' sugar if desired. Serve warm or cold.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 282 calories, Fat 9g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 13mg cholesterol, Sodium 237mg sodium, Carbohydrate 48g carbohydrate (31g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 4g protein.

3/4 cup raisins
1 cup hot water
1/2 cup shortening
2 cups sugar
1 large egg
2-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on each ground cinnamon, cloves and nutmeg
1-1/2 cups applesauce
1/2 cup water
1/2 cup chopped walnuts
Confectioners' sugar, optional

POLISH APPLE CAKE (SZARLOTKA)

This traditional spiced cake is served with a cinnamon whipped cream and a dusting of icing sugar

Provided by Ren Behan

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h35m

Number Of Ingredients 15



Polish apple cake (Szarlotka) image

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 180C/160C fan/gas 4. Grease and line a 20 x 29cm baking tray with baking parchment.
  • For the filling, zest the lemon half and leave aside for the dough. Peel, core and thinly slice the apples, then squeeze over the juice of the lemon to stop the fruit turning brown. Put the apples in a large pan and add the sugar, 200ml water and cinnamon. Cook for 5 mins, then remove from the heat and leave to cool in the liquid (you'll need this later).
  • To make the dough, put the flour and baking powder in a food processor or into a large bowl and pulse or stir to combine. Add the butter and mix again until the mixture is sandy. Add the sugar, egg yolks and egg, yogurt, lemon zest and vanilla extract and mix into a dough. Tip it out onto a floured surface. Bring it together with your hands and roll it into a ball.
  • Split the dough in half, wrap one half in cling film and freeze for 1 hr. Roll out the other dough half so that it is big enough to fill the bottom of the lined tray. With the palm of your hand, push the dough about halfway up the sides of the tray until the whole base is covered. Prick the dough with a fork and bake in the oven for about 15 mins until it is golden and lightly springy to the touch.
  • Spoon over the apple filling, with about half the cooking liquid, then set aside.
  • Remove the dough from the freezer and coarsely grate, as you would a block of cheese. Sprinkle the grated dough over the apples and bake for 40-45 mins until it is golden and the topping has cooked through. Leave to cool completely, dust with icing sugar, then cut into squares. Whip the cream until thick, stir in the cinnamon and serve alongside the cake.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 398 calories, Fat 16 grams fat, SaturatedFat 9 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 60 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 33 grams sugar, Fiber 3 grams fiber, Protein 5 grams protein, Sodium 0.1 milligram of sodium

half a lemon
6 large Bramley or cooking apples
4 tbsp soft brown sugar
1 tbsp ground cinnamon
450g plain flour , plus extra for dusting
1 tsp baking powder
200g unsalted butter , cut into pieces, plus extra for greasing
225g golden caster sugar
3 egg yolks , plus 1 whole egg, at room temperature
1 tbsp natural yogurt
1 tbsp lemon zest (from the half a lemon, above)
1 tsp vanilla extract
icing sugar , for dusting
300ml pot whipping cream
1 tsp cinnamon

APPLESAUCE CAKE

Applesauce makes this cake exceptionally moist. It's delicious on its own or served with a scoop of vanilla ice cream. If you decide to use store-bought applesauce, choose one with a chunky texture.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Dessert & Treats Recipes     Cake Recipes     Bundt Cake Recipes

Time 2h30m

Number Of Ingredients 12



Applesauce Cake image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. In a large b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, and cardamom. Set aside.
  • In another bowl, with an electric mixer, beat butter, brown sugar, and honey until light and fluffy. Add eggs, one at a time, beating until combined. With mixer on low speed, gradually add flour mixture; beat just until combined. Beat in applesauce.
  • Generously coat a nonstick 9-inch tube pan with cooking spray. Spoon batter into pan; smooth top. Bake until a toothpick inserted in the middle comes out clean (but slightly wet), 50 to 60 minutes.
  • Cool on a wire rack 10 minutes. Turn out of pan onto a cutting board or baking sheet; invert cake onto rack, top side up. Cool completely. Dust with confectioners' sugar before serving, if desired.

3 cups all-purpose flour, spooned and leveled
2 teaspoons ba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
1 1/2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
1 1/4 teaspoons ground cardamom
1 cup (2 sticks) unsalted butter, room temperature
2 cups packed light-brown sugar
1/4 cup honey
2 large eggs
2 cups Basic Applesauce, or store-bought chunky applesauce
Nonstick cooking spray
Confectioners' sugar, for dusting (optional)
